What You Should Know About Bonding

At first glance, you may mix up dental bonding with contouring. Which one does which and what do you actually need? Sometimes, such as with a very small chip, either cosmetic treatment will work. It all depends on your final goal. So how do I know which is which? you may ask yourself. Keep the following in your mind:

  • Contouring removes tissue
  • Bonding adds tissue
